2Scope / Description
This standard establishes a comprehensive framework for assessing the quality management team activities within tobacco enterprises. It defines specific criteria and methodologies to evaluate the effectiveness, organization, and outcomes of team-based quality initiatives conducted on-site. The document outlines detailed requirements for project selection, data analysis, action implementation, and result verification, ensuring that teams adhere to systematic improvement processes. By providing a standardized approach for review and scoring, it facilitates consistent evaluation of team performance across different organizational units. The guidelines cover essential aspects such as team formation, objective setting, and the application of statistical tools for problem-solving. This resource serves as a reference for internal auditors and quality managers seeking to benchmark their team activities against established industry practices. It emphasizes the importance of continuous improvement and employee engagement in driving operational excellence. The content is designed to support the identification of strengths and areas for development within quality circles, fostering a culture of quality throughout the sector.
